JOB DESCRIPTIONYOUR ROLE

The Clinical Services Coordinator team provides efficient and accurate responses to external customers (physicians, office staff, pharmacy providers, members, and brokers) and internal team members for all outpatient pharmacy benefit inquiries. The Clinical Services Coordinator, Intermediate, will report to the Operations Supervisor. In this role you will assist with data entry, outbound calls, run reports and manage authorization queues.

In this role, you will:

  • Assist with member notifications sent out to providers and Members
  • Ensure all notifications are completed within turn-around times to meet compliance
  • Run, sort and filter daily internal reports for manual outreach
  • Make outbound calls to BSC members and providers related to decisioned prior authorization request
  • Data entry related to authorization request, high risk member information, HIPPA authorizations information for case creation
  • Support to Advanced/Specialist CSC
  • Research member eligibility/benefits and provider network
